SUMMARY
The forum discussion centers on conducting electrical load studies for an engineering college, involving eight students assigned by their department head. The objective is to measure load consumption across various departments at different times and recommend effective power management strategies. A suggested approach includes visiting each department to catalog electrical loads and assigning utilization factors based on usage duration.
